Choosing The Right Compactor for Your Needs: Static vs. Portable Options

Determining the ideal compactor depends heavily on individual requirements and workflow. Static compactors, as the name implies, are permanently installed units designed for high-volume compacting. These devices offer impressive capacity but require a dedicated area. In contrast, portable compactors provide mobility, making them ideal for smaller areas where stationary setup is not feasible.

Streamlining Waste Operations: Choosing the Best Compactor Type

Efficiently managing waste is crucial to any thriving operation. A key component of this process is choosing the right waste compactor for your specific needs.

There are numerous types of compactors available, each with its own advantages.

For example, stationary compactors offer high volume, while mobile compactors provide mobility for various waste streams. Factors like the nature of waste generated, space constraints, and your budget will all influence your decision.

Carefully evaluating these factors will help you select the most appropriate compactor type to streamline your waste operations and maximize output.
